There is a legend that during the Russian-Turkish War of 1736 Russian troops were almost defeated because of the interruption of their usual supply of sourdough rye bread, when they were forced to eat unleavened wheat bread. Dec 13, 2013 · Regarding the rye malt syrup, in Andrew Whitley's book Bread Matters, for his Borodinsky bread recipe, he mentions substituting "suslo" the rye malt syrup with a mix of blackstrap molasses and barley malt, both of which I have easier access to. Borodinsky bread has been traditionally made (with the definite recipe fixed by a ГОСТ 5309-50 standard) from a mixture of no less than 80% by weight of a whole-grain rye flour with about 15% of a second-grade wheat flour and about 5% of rye, or rarely, barley malt, often leavened by a separately prepared starter culture made like a choux pastry, by diluting the flour by a near-boiling (95 Apr 29, 2021 · This recipe for the famous Russian Borodinsky bread hits all the authentic flavors.
